Definition
☆ za·ca·tón (sä′kä tōn′)
noun
- any of various wiry grasses of the SW U.S. and Mexico: used in making brushes, paper, etc.
- sacaton
Etymology: Sp, augmentative of zacate, grass < Nahuatl sakaλ
